Feature
Story 1: "The Bells of Doom"
The Sorceress warns the heroic warriors, and summons
He-Man to Grayskull, to tell him that Skeletor has found
the location of the Bells of Doom. If he can ring the
Seven Bells, he will gain great power for half a day,
and be able to command all the evil warriors on Eternia!
He-Man sets off, with Orko, Moss Man, Fisto and Snout
Spout, to the Sea of Silence where the bells are located.
But Tri-Klops is spying on them, and reports back to
Skeletor that they will not survive the sea of silence.
The heroic warriors dive in, and they find the lost
underwater city of Moraturia..... (cont'd in part 2)

Feature
Story 2: "The Bells of Doom", Cont'd
In the underwater city of Moraturia, the heroic warriors
are attacked by robot sharks. He-Man is swept away by
a powerful current, carrying him far away, as the water
around Moraturia is drained away. The other warriors
attempt to stop the bells from ringing- but they are
too late, as Skeletor causes the ground to shake, ringing
the bells. Then a glass dome appears over the city,
trapping Fisto, Moss Man, and Snout Spout inisde. But
He-Man has been washed up on the shore, and makes his
way back to Orko and Battle Cat. He has lost his sword
in the current, and must get it back. Meanwhile, Skeletor
has now gained control of all the evil warriors on Eternia-
even Hordak and the Snake Men- and they march towards
Eternos for a massive invasion! (cont'd in part 3)
Feature
Story 3: "The Bells of Doom", Cont'd
Skeletor, and all the other evil warriors, pause to
rest near the silent sea to await the rest of the troops.
He-Man and Orko are lurking nearby, and Orko cats a
spell to create false fire balls, accompanied by the
sound of Ghost Drums. All the evil warriors flee except
Skeletor, the only one who senses it is not a real attack.
Just then, he sees He-Man's sword- unprotected- and
rushes towards it! But He-Man comes towards it at the
same time, and grabs it before Skeletor can! Skeletor
quickly teleports back to Snake Mountain, and He-Man
and Orko meet the other warriors on the other side of
the sea, and return home.
